Norway’s Statoil is set to host key meetings this month with a select group of contractors vying to build the hull and living quarters (LQ) for a newbuild floating production, storage and offloading vessel for its $9 billion Johan Castberg project in the Barents Sea.

Market sources described the meetings as “familiarisation talks” that aim to orientate bidders on Statoil’s contracting strategy for the hull-LQ package and how that fits into its overall development approach for Johan Castberg.
